I erect the first walls of a charred wood basement, a foundation for my off-grid wilderness log cabin. A bear visits and I chase it away before my dog sees it. I build a raised bed in my greenhouse and install drip lines and a water pump powered by solar panels. Cali, my Golden Retriever, and I explore a local lake by canoe and a bull moose and whitetailed deer visit our remote homestead.

My 1930s cabin had a wood basement, I'm guessing coated in creosote. At some point they put a concrete block wall inside the wood one. I had to excavate recently and found the old wood, most of it turning to dust. A couple boards were intact and remarkably smelled like fresh pine when I broke one.
